WebFeb 9, 2024 · Which means your VARCHAR date is at least 2.67 times the size of a DATE. 3.33 if you include separators. Or much larger if your string dates are not formatted sets of digits. That's not huge, and probably not a concern for space on disk. But for space in memory, when you need to fetch or sort the data, it adds up. Standardize date formats: To avoid confusion and make it easier to work with date and time data, it's a good idea to standardize date formats across your SQL database.This means using the same format for all date and time data, such … WebAug 11, 2015 · 1 DATETIME in SQL Server is always a binary, 8-byte long column - you cannot "define" a length for it (since it's NOT a string being stored!) But if you intend to store just the date alone - without any time portion - as the "length of 8" seems to imply - then use the DATE datatype instead - that stores date only (no time portion) Share Follow
